Transaction 88fab213d4c93850f3f8e356069631f18f87237341c0521eb70bb32b9feacda3
1 Input
1 Output
-
88fab213d4c93850f3f8e356069631f18f87237341c0521eb70bb32b9feacda3:0
- value
- 12999618
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d1ad5a2afaf52037e093e286c56b6f5853e2b45
- address
- ltc1qe5ddtg404afqxlsf8c5xc44k7kznu26967hu34